如何优化Arcane Diffusion模型的性能
引言
在当今的AI领域,模型的性能优化是提升应用效果和用户体验的关键步骤。无论是用于生成艺术作品、设计创意内容,还是进行科学研究,模型的性能直接影响到最终的输出质量和效率。Arcane Diffusion模型作为一款基于Stable Diffusion的微调模型,专门用于生成《Arcane》风格的图像,其性能优化尤为重要。本文将深入探讨影响模型性能的因素,并提供一系列优化方法和实践技巧,帮助用户更好地利用Arcane Diffusion模型。
主体
影响性能的因素
硬件配置
硬件配置是影响模型性能的首要因素。对于Arcane Diffusion模型,GPU的性能尤为关键。高性能的GPU能够显著加速图像生成过程,尤其是在处理大规模数据集时。此外,内存大小和带宽也会影响模型的运行效率。如果硬件配置不足,可能会导致模型运行缓慢甚至崩溃。
参数设置
模型的参数设置直接影响其性能。例如,学习率、批量大小、训练步数等参数的选择都会对模型的收敛速度和最终效果产生影响。对于Arcane Diffusion模型,合理设置这些参数可以提高生成图像的质量和速度。
数据质量
数据质量是模型性能的另一个重要因素。高质量的训练数据能够帮助模型更好地学习目标风格,从而生成更逼真的图像。对于Arcane Diffusion模型,训练数据的多样性和代表性尤为重要,因为这直接影响到模型对《Arcane》风格的捕捉能力。
优化方法
调整关键参数
调整关键参数是优化模型性能的直接方法。对于Arcane Diffusion模型,可以通过调整学习率、批量大小和训练步数来优化性能。例如,适当降低学习率可以提高模型的稳定性,而增加批量大小则可以加速训练过程。
使用高效算法
使用高效算法是提升模型性能的另一重要手段。例如,可以使用混合精度训练(Mixed Precision Training)来减少内存占用并加速计算。此外,模型剪枝和量化技术也可以显著降低模型的计算复杂度,从而提高运行效率。
模型剪枝和量化
模型剪枝和量化是减少模型大小和计算复杂度的有效方法。通过剪枝,可以去除模型中不重要的权重,从而减少模型的参数量。而量化则可以将模型的权重从浮点数转换为整数,进一步减少计算量和内存占用。这些技术对于在资源受限的设备上运行Arcane Diffusion模型尤为重要。
实践技巧
性能监测工具
使用性能监测工具可以帮助用户实时了解模型的运行状态。例如,可以使用TensorBoard来监控模型的训练过程,查看损失函数的变化和生成图像的质量。通过这些工具,用户可以及时发现并解决性能瓶颈。
实验记录和分析
实验记录和分析是优化模型性能的重要步骤。通过记录每次实验的参数设置和结果,用户可以系统地分析不同参数对模型性能的影响,从而找到最佳的配置。此外,实验记录还可以帮助用户复现成功的优化方案,避免重复劳动。
案例分享
优化前后的对比
在实际应用中,优化前后的性能对比往往是最直观的效果展示。例如,通过调整学习率和批量大小,Arcane Diffusion模型的生成速度可以提升30%,同时生成图像的质量也有显著提高。这种对比不仅证明了优化方法的有效性,也为用户提供了具体的优化方向。
成功经验总结
在优化过程中,总结成功经验是非常重要的。例如,通过混合精度训练和模型剪枝,用户可以在不显著降低生成质量的情况下,将模型的运行时间减少50%。这些经验可以为其他用户提供宝贵的参考,帮助他们更快地实现性能优化。
结论
优化Arcane Diffusion模型的性能不仅能够提升生成图像的质量和速度,还能为用户节省大量的计算资源。通过合理调整参数、使用高效算法和实践技巧,用户可以显著提升模型的性能。我们鼓励读者尝试这些优化方法,并根据自己的需求进行调整,以获得最佳的生成效果。
通过本文的介绍,相信读者已经对如何优化Arcane Diffusion模型的性能有了更深入的了解。希望这些方法能够帮助你在实际应用中取得更好的效果,并激发更多的创意和灵感。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考



